Canton, Texas is located in the northeastern part of the state and has a humid subtropical climate with hot summers and mild winters. The area is prone to occasional flooding due to its proximity to several rivers, including the Sabine River and the Trinity River. The hydrology constituents of the area include a mix of water sources, including surface water and groundwater. Outdoor recreation opportunities in Canton include fishing and boating on nearby lakes, such as Lake Tawakoni and Lake Fork, as well as hiking and camping in the nearby state parks, including Tyler State Park and Lake Bob Sandlin State Park. Additionally, Canton is well-known for its First Monday Trade Days, a large flea market that takes place on the weekend before the first Monday of each month.

Canton receives approximately 1100mm of rain per year, with humidity levels near 78% and air temperatures averaging around 19°C. Canton has a plant hardyness factor of 8, meaning plants and agriculture in this region tend to thrive here all year round.
